Financial markets are highly competitive and information-driven.
A delayed research response may reduce the usefulness of an investment insight because prices often adjust rapidly once information becomes widely understood.
For example:
| Event | Market Reaction Speed |
|---|---|
| Earnings surprise | Minutes or hours |
| Interest-rate decision | Immediate |
| Sector guidance revision | Same trading session |
| Commodity-price shock | Rapid cross-sector impact |
This means research teams need systems capable of processing financial information efficiently and continuously.

One of the biggest advantages of modern trend-analysis systems is real-time earnings tracking.
These tools automatically monitor:
For example:
| Earnings Signal | Potential Interpretation |
|---|---|
| Rising margins | Operational improvement |
| Weak guidance | Future demand pressure |
| Revenue acceleration | Sector momentum |
| Inventory buildup | Potential slowdown risk |
Automated monitoring allows analysts to respond much faster during earnings seasons.

Sector analysis tools help investors track how industries behave relative to each other.
Analysts monitor sectors such as:
Sector trend systems help identify:
For example:
| Sector Trend | Possible Interpretation |
|---|---|
| Technology outperformance | Growth optimism |
| Defensive-sector inflows | Economic caution |
| Banking weakness | Credit-market concern |
| Energy strength | Commodity expansion |
Sector trend analysis improves portfolio positioning significantly.
Modern research tools also monitor macroeconomic indicators continuously.
Analysts track:
Macroeconomic monitoring helps investors understand how economic conditions may affect:
For example:
| Macroeconomic Shift | Potential Market Impact |
|---|---|
| Rising rates | Growth-stock pressure |
| Lower inflation | Margin stabilization |
| Commodity surge | Energy-sector strength |
| Weak employment | Consumer-demand slowdown |
This improves both tactical and long-term investment analysis.
